1. Regular Engine Oil Change
Old oil becomes thick and dirty, which affects engine performance.
Tip: Change engine oil every 5,000–7,000 km.

2. Check Brake Pads Every 10,000 km
Brakes are the most critical safety component in any vehicle.
Tip: Replace brake pads if you hear grinding noises or feel vibration.

3. Maintain Tyre Health & Alignment
Uneven tyres reduce mileage and increase risk.
Tip: Check tyre pressure weekly; rotate tyres every 8,000–10,000 km.

4. Battery Inspection Every 6 Months
Most used car batteries last 2–3 years.
Tip: Check battery terminals for corrosion and ensure proper charging.

5. Coolant & Radiator Check
Overheating is common in older vehicles.
Tip: Flush and refill coolant once a year.

6. Air & Cabin Filter Cleaning
Clogged filters reduce performance and AC efficiency.
Tip: Replace air filter every 15,000 km.

7. Suspension Check for Smooth Ride
Used cars may have worn-out shocks.
Tip: If the car feels bouncy or unstable, get the suspension inspected.

8. Scan for Error Codes
Modern cars use sensors to detect problems.
Tip: Do an OBD scanner check during every service.

9. AC Servicing Before Summer
For better cooling and fuel efficiency.
Tip: Clean AC condenser and check refrigerant gas levels.

10. Follow a Consistent Service Schedule
Consistency keeps used cars running like new.
Tip: Maintain a service record book for future resale value.
